The global Virtual Assistant market is rapidly expanding, reflecting significant advancements in artificial intelligence (AI) and natural language processing (NLP) technologies. Virtual Assistants, which are software applications designed to assist users by understanding and responding to voice commands or text inputs, have become integral to various industries, ranging from customer service to personal productivity. These AI-driven solutions are capable of performing a wide array of tasks, such as scheduling appointments, providing information, and controlling smart home devices, thereby enhancing user convenience and operational efficiency.
A Virtual Assistant operates by utilizing sophisticated algorithms to interpret user queries, process information, and deliver appropriate responses. This technology leverages AI and machine learning to continuously improve its accuracy and capabilities. Virtual Assistants can be embedded in various devices, including smartphones, computers, smart speakers, and even vehicles, making them accessible and versatile tools for both personal and professional use.
The adoption of Virtual Assistants is driven by their ability to streamline workflows, reduce the burden of routine tasks, and provide instant access to information. Businesses are increasingly incorporating Virtual Assistants into their operations to enhance customer engagement, improve service delivery, and optimize internal processes. In the consumer market, Virtual Assistants offer personalized experiences, helping users manage their daily activities and access digital services more efficiently.

Media
Media includes voice, chat, and multimodal interfaces embedded across apps, devices, and contact centers. Buyers value technological advancements in natural language understanding, context retention, and low-latency responses that elevate customer experience and self-service containment. Vendors expand through partnerships with cloud platforms, CRM suites, and device OEMs to broaden reach, while managing challenges around accuracy, personalization, and responsible AI.
Fax
Fax type assistants automate intake, routing, and extraction from faxed documents in industries with entrenched compliance and record-keeping workflows. The growth thesis centers on bridging analog inputs with digital case systems, reducing manual keying and turnaround times. Solutions differentiate via expansion into intelligent OCR, secure transmission, and audit trails, addressing challenges in format variability, privacy, and integration with legacy repositories.
Others
Others spans specialized implementations such as kiosk assistants, in-vehicle copilots, and edge-deployed agents tuned for constrained environments. These solutions pursue niche strategies where latency, offline capability, or form factor is decisive, creating defensible positions against generalized platforms. Vendors focus on future outlook through domain-specific knowledge, safety layers, and ecosystem partnerships to accelerate time-to-value while mitigating challenges in maintenance and model drift.

BFSI
In BFSI, virtual assistants handle balance queries, card controls, fraud alerts, and onboarding with stringent security and auditability. Banks prioritize partnerships with core-banking and identity providers to ensure compliant workflows across channels. Growth stems from reduced call volumes and better cross-sell, tempered by challenges in explaining recommendations and aligning with evolving regulatory expectations.
Retail & Ecommerce
Retail & Ecommerce deployments focus on guided discovery, sizing support, and order management to lift conversion and lower returns. Integrations with OMS, PIM, and CRM enable end-to-end journeys from search to support, while conversational merchandising boosts AOV. Challenges include catalog complexity, seasonal content refresh, and ensuring brand-safe responses, addressed through technological advancements in retrieval-augmented generation and approval workflows.
Automotive
In Automotive, assistants power in-vehicle voice, service scheduling, and dealer support, improving safety and convenience. OEMs and suppliers pursue partnerships for navigation, infotainment, and telematics, aiming for cohesive experiences across mobile apps and dashboards. Growth is supported by connected-car penetration, while challenges include on-device performance, multilingual robustness, and lifecycle updates across model years.
Healthcare
Healthcare assistants streamline symptom triage, appointment scheduling, and benefits verification while maintaining privacy and clinical safety. Provider and payer organizations integrate with EHR and contact-center stacks to reduce wait times and administrative burden. Challenges include medical accuracy, sensitive intent handling, and documentation quality, addressed via strategies such as clinician-in-the-loop review and domain-tuned models.

-  Proliferation of Smart Devices and IoT : The proliferation of smart devices and the Internet of Things (IoT) ecosystem is a significant driver for the virtual assistant market. With the increasing adoption of IoT devices in both consumer and industrial settings, the demand for virtual assistants has surged. These assistants seamlessly integrate into smartphones, smart speakers, home automation systems, and a variety of other IoT devices, offering users convenient voice-activated control and automation capabilities. As consumers embrace smart technology to enhance their daily lives, virtual assistants become an essential component, providing intuitive interfaces for managing tasks, accessing information, and controlling connected devices. The synergy between virtual assistants and IoT devices extends beyond consumer applications. In industrial settings, virtual assistants integrated into IoT platforms facilitate automation, predictive maintenance, and real-time monitoring, driving efficiency and productivity. As the IoT ecosystem continues to expand and evolve, the demand for virtual assistants is expected to grow, fueled by their ability to enhance user experiences and streamline operations across various domains.

-  Complexity in Training and Integration : Training AI models for virtual assistants to comprehend and respond effectively across various languages and dialects presents a multifaceted challenge, demanding significant resources and expertise. Achieving linguistic versatility necessitates extensive data collection, annotation, and model fine-tuning, all of which incur substantial time and computational costs. Moreover, maintaining accuracy and coherence across diverse linguistic nuances adds layers of complexity to the training process, requiring ongoing refinement and optimization efforts to ensure satisfactory performance across linguistic boundaries. On the integration front, incorporating virtual assistants seamlessly into existing ecosystems of software, hardware, and applications poses a separate set of hurdles. Compatibility issues, disparate data formats, and differing protocols often require intricate customization efforts, prolonging integration timelines and escalating development expenditures. Furthermore, ensuring smooth interoperability while preserving data integrity and security mandates meticulous planning and execution, underscoring the intricate nature of integrating virtual assistant technologies into diverse organizational infrastructures.
